




Kohkhokhao Camping is located on Koh Kho Khao island in Phangnga province. Access requires taking a car ferry to the island, with a fee of 200 baht per vehicle and no charge for passengers. The ferry operates on a fixed schedule with vehicles boarding first and disembarking last. Motorcyclists can use smaller boats without waiting for scheduled departures. The campsite sits at the end of the island's single main road, making navigation straightforward. An on-site restaurant and bungalows provide dining options for those who prefer not to cook. Visitors can enjoy kayaking, swimming, and beachside barbecues along the Andaman Sea coastline, which runs parallel to Khao Na Yak and Laem Phrom Thep in Phuket. The site is recognized for its sunset views over the ocean. As a designated dark sky conservation area, the location offers excellent conditions for stargazing and viewing the Milky Way during early morning hours. Facilities include electricity, water supply, restrooms, and showers. The camping fee is 150 baht per person per night, and equipment rental is available.

Superb. Very quite. Beautiful beachfront plot. Toilets and showers were very adequate and kept clean. There's a couple of standup boards available. Electric dropped out a couple of times when it rained. Pet friendly. Sunset beach cafe and bar is handy. (100m). The beach massage was superb. (Book it at the bar) No nearby local shops so bring everything you're likely to need. You can buy bags of ice from the bar. My 2nd visit & I'll be back again for sure.
Good place, and friendly owner 🤙 have everything you need, also 3km away from camp have local shop, and local restaurants. Best place to peacefull relax. Keep it clean guys when you will come here hahaha
The camping is situated right on an amazing beach. Amazing view on the sea and sunset. The owner is very friendly and will help you if you need something. There is some shade from pine trees. Also there are tents for rent. Electricity can be provided. Every Tuesday you can go to a small market about 5 km from the camping. There are restaurants in the neighbourhood. I would give it 5 stars if the toilets and showers would be cleaned regularly. Electricity network not stable. It drops to 160 volts every minute.
Nice and private huge beach. Has electric but not strong so if using battery or aircon make sure you are charged before u arrive as only good to top up battery slowly. They are making a new restaurant and will be open next month. Friendly people Definitely worth the visit. 200 baht per person. Has toilet and shower
Stayed 2 nights will stay longer next time. Lovely beach, 2 restaurants nearby, water and electricity provided to our campervan and included in 200 baht per person per night fee. Very quiet and peaceful, sun beds and ATV’s available, very pet friendly
